UNIT AI raises $12 million to scale modular warehouse automation
UNIT AI raised $12 million to expand North American deployments, product development and commercial growth for its modular warehouse-automation platform, which is already used by customers including Barrett, ShipCalm, DaVinci and Carter.

Evidence notes
- Dynamo Ventures, Prologis Ventures and Ground Up Ventures co-led the $12 million financing, with five additional investors participating.
- UNIT AI’s modular system can begin in approximately 1,000 square feet without a major facility redesign and targets payback within 12 months.
- After 22 months, UNIT AI identified Barrett, ShipCalm, DaVinci and Carter as customers; the new capital will expand deployment capacity, product development and commercial growth across North America.
